> +
> +   @Override
> +   public IpPermission apply(FirewallRule input) {
> +      IpPermission.Builder permissionBuilder = new IpPermission.Builder();
> +      String destinationPort = input.getDestinationPort();
> +      if (destinationPort != null) {
> +         if (destinationPort.contains("!")) {
> +            destinationPort = 
> destinationPort.substring(destinationPort.indexOf("!") + 1,
> +                  destinationPort.length());
> +         }
> +         if (destinationPort.contains(":")) {
> +            int[] ports = parsePort(destinationPort);
> +            permissionBuilder.fromPort(ports[0]);
> +            permissionBuilder.toPort(ports[1]);
> +         } else {
> +            permissionBuilder.fromPort(Integer.parseInt(destinationPort));

[minor] Factor `Integer.parseInt(destinationPort)` out as a variable?

---
Reply to this email directly or view it on GitHub:
https://github.com/jclouds/jclouds-labs/pull/70/files#r17825942

Reply via email to